Parliament committee passes decision to dismiss ECM Vice President

Parliamentary Committee on Independent Institutions has passed the decision to dismiss Vice President of Elections Commission of the Maldives (ECM) Ahmed Akram, over allegations of sexual harassment.

The committee approved the dismissal motion on November 18, after conducting an inquiry into the allegations. During the inquiry process, the victim and other members of ECM were summoned to the committee for questioning, along with Akram.

Akram was appointed to ECM for a second term on March 23. He had also previously served as commissioner and spokesperson at ECM.
